BHU UG Cut Off 2024 - The Banaras Hindu University has released the BHU UG 2024 cut off for mop up round 2 on October 10. Candidates can check the BHU 2024 cut off for mop up round 2 by visiting the official website at bhucuet.samarth.edu.in. The deadline of fee payment for BHU UG 2024 cut off for mop-up round 2 is October 13. The university released the BHU UG cut off for mop up round 1 on October 7, 2024.
Earlier, the university had released the BHU UG 2024 cut off for spot round 2 on September 20 in online mode. Applicants who clear the cut off will be eligible to appear in the BHU UG merit list 2024. Students can check the BHU cutoff 2024 from the link provided in the article. To check the cutoff for BHU UG admission 2024, candidates are required to enter their login credentials. Candidates who secure equal or more marks than BHU UG admission list 2024 are invited to the next round of admission of BHU University.
The BHU UG cutoff 2024 defines the minimum marks required for eligibility for admission to a number of UG courses at Banaras Hindu University. The BHU cut off 2024 CUET UG is prepared based on various factors such as the difficulty level of the exam, previous year trends for Banaras Hindu University cut off, number of students applying and seats availability. Knowing the previous BHU CUET cut off will help candidates predict what they should expect from the cutoff of this year. The university releases cutoff requirements separately for different courses like BHU agriculture cut off. Check the BHU cut off for CUET UG from previous years in the table below.
Banaras Hindu University offers admissions for various UG courses based on the marks secured in the CUET entrance exam. Candidates are required to appear for the CUET exam 2024 to be eligible for CUET BHU admission 2024. Candidates who qualified in CUET UG 2024 are eligible for BHU admission in UG courses. Candidates are selected based on the CUET score for the CUET BHU admission process 2024. Eligible candidates who have scored over Banaras Hindu University cut off are taken forward in the admission process.

Candidates who clear the BHU cutoff 0224 CUET UG with higher ranks are called for counselling and then similarly candidates with comparatively lower ranks will be invited in the next rounds. To attend the BHU counselling 2024, candidates have to download the counselling call letter from the counselling portal by using their roll number and date of birth. The counselling process will be done based on the BHU UG cut off 2024. After completing the BHU UG counselling registration 2024, the candidates have to visit their respective departments at the scheduled date and time and complete the admission formalities.

For Class 11 admissions at Central Hindu School (CHS) through the Banaras Hindu University School Entrance Test (BHU SET), the syllabus primarily covers subjects studied up to Class 10. This includes topics from English, Hindi, Mathematics, Science, Social Science, and General Studies. The exam consists of multiple-choice questions based on these subjects.

Yes, BHU offers the BNYS (Bachelor of Naturopathy and Yogic Sciences) course . To get admission, candidates must have completed 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ology, securing at least 50% marks. They should be at least 17 years old.
Admission is based on the NEET-UG exam score, followed by Uttar Pradesh Ayush NEET counseling. Candidates must apply through the official counseling process to secure a seat in BHU's BNYS program.
